No hallmarks remain but - These come with a certificate from the assay office in the Czech Republic where the metal was tested and verified to 585 (14k gold) and platinum. We often see these numerical hallmarks on European pieces where a three digit number is used to represent the parts per thousand of gold (14k being 585, etc.).
